Our Mission
Excellence, Integrity, People-First
Apogee, defined as the farthest or highest point, conveys our commitment to our investors to help them reach their highest potential. As a company, we seek to provide multifamily investing as an avenue for our clients to reach financial freedom so they can have the time and resources to live their calling.

Jonathan Nichols
CEO & Co-Founder
Jonathan Nichols is a real estate investor local to the DFW metroplex. He began his REI career after having worked for almost ten years in the aerospace engineering industry as a propulsion engineer where he analyzed and integrated turboshaft engines on helicopter platforms. He holds a B.S. degree and a M.S. degree in Aerospace Engineering from Texas A&M and Virginia Polytechnical Institute respectively.
He and his wife Paula first began their investing journey in 2018 and have undertaken numerous different types of projects before forming their multifamily investing company Apogee Capital in 2019. His past real estate projects include a 75-unit A class apartment complex in College Station, TX as a GP, two 100+ unit complexes in the Tulsa MSA as a GP, an 8-unit apartment to STR conversation in Arlington, TX as a GP and almost 1000 units investing as an LP. Additionally, he has numerous residential real estate investments including a 20+ unit short-term rental business in the Arlington Entertainment District. Known as a person with a high work ethic,
Jonathan enjoys helping others to achieve their goals (financial or otherwise). Outside of work, he enjoys spending his time racing in Ironman triathlons and traveling with his wife.
Paula Nichols
Co-Founder
Paula Nichols is a real estate professional with experience in project management, investment analysis and contract negotiation. She began her career as a management consultant where she worked on multiple projects with clients in the banking and utility sectors. Paula and her husband, Jonathan, co-founded Apogee Capital a multifamily real estate investing firm where they syndicate apartments in Texas and Oklahoma. Paula also works as a pre-development project manager at ECM Development where she manages single family rental and lot development projects ranging from $14MM to $25MM in value. She holds a B.S. degree in Business Administration - Finance from Texas A&M University. Paula is a licensed real estate agent and a certified ScrumMaster®.
Paula is passionate about entrepreneurship and excels at finding creative solutions to complex problems. Outside of work she enjoys serving at her local church, spending time with friends, and traveling with Jonathan.

Greg Monroe
Attorney
Greg is a partner at Baker Monroe, a boutique transactional firm focusing on commercial real estate and lending matters.
Greg’s practice focuses on commercial real estate and lending transactions. Greg represents developers, banks, owners, landlords, and tenants, handling purchase and sales, leasing, development, and commercial real estate lending matters.
Along with his commercial real estate practice, Greg handles lending transactions, corporate matters, and entity formations associated with real estate transactions. Greg was admitted to the State Bar in 2007 upon completion of his J.D. from Texas Wesleyan University School of Law, Fort Worth, Texas, and is Board Certified in Commercial Real Estate Law.
